What is a disadvantage of a between subjects design?

The main disadvantage with between subjects designs is that they can be complex and often require a large number of participants to generate any useful and analyzable data. Because each participant is only measured once, researchers need to add a new group for every treatment and manipulation.

Why is random assignment used in between subjects designs?

Randomly select the participants from the population. In a between-subjects experiment, participants are assigned to treatments using random assignment. Why is random assignment used? It is an attempt to control participant variables so they don’t become confounding variables.

What happens in a between subjects design?

Between-subjects is a type of experimental design in which the subjects of an experiment are assigned to different conditions, with each subject experiencing only one of the experimental conditions. This is a common design used in psychology and other social science fields.

What is an example of random assignment?

Overview. Random assignment might involve tactics such as flipping a coin, drawing names out of a hat, rolling dice, or assigning random numbers to participants.

What is an in between study?

Between-subjects (or between-groups) study design: different people test each condition, so that each person is only exposed to a single user interface. Within-subjects (or repeated-measures) study design: the same person tests all the conditions (i.e., all the user interfaces).

Which is an example of a completely randomized experimental design?

In a between-subjects experimental design, participants are assigned to different treatment groups such that each individual is exposed to only one level of the manipulation. The idealized case is known as a completely randomized (CR) design, because subjects are assigned completely at random to a specific treatment level.

Which is an alternative to a between-subjects design?

The alternative to a between-subjects design is a within-subjects design, where each participant experiences all conditions. Researchers test the same participants repeatedly to assess differences between conditions.
